How to turn off motion blur in Palworld?

  1. Access Settings:

    • Start by launching Palworld on your PC or Xbox.
    • Once in the game, either from the main menu or during gameplay, look for the Settings option. This option can usually be found in a menu accessed by pressing the Esc key on your keyboard or the Options button on your controller.
  2. Navigate to graphics settings:

    • In the Settings menu, navigate to the Graphics section. Here you can adjust visual settings related to game graphics, including motion blur.
  3. Find the motion blur settings:

    • Scroll through the graphics settings until you find the Motion Blur option. Depending on the game’s menu layout, it may be listed under a subsection or in a separate category.
  4. Disable motion blur:

    • Once you find the Motion Blur setting, select it to turn it off. This should turn off the motion blur effect in the game.
  5. Apply changes:

    • After disabling motion blur, make sure to apply the changes and save them. This is usually done by selecting the Apply or Save button in the Settings menu.

If the above steps don’t work due to game setup issues, you can try the following alternatives:

  1. To access game files:

    • Open File Explorer on your PC and navigate to the Palworld installation directory.
  2. Find the Engine.ini file:

    • Look for a file called Engine.ini in the game directory. This file contains various settings related to the game engine and graphics.
  3. Edit the Engine.ini file:

    • Right-click the Engine.ini file and choose to open it with a text editor such as Notepad.
  4. Add motion blur disable command:

    • Scroll to the end of the file and add the following lines:
  1. [SystemSettings]
  2. r.MotionBlur.Max=0
  3. r.MotionBlurQuality=0
  4. r.DefaultFeature.MotionBlur=0
  5. save Changes:

    • Save the changes to the Engine.ini file and close the text editor.
  6. Make the file read-only:

    • Right-click on the Engine.ini file, go to Properties, and check the Read-only box to prevent the game from overwriting your changes.

By following these steps, you should be able to turn off motion blur in Palworld either through in-game settings or by modifying the game’s configuration files.

friend world

Palworld is a game produced by the Japanese company Pocket Pair. It’s about exploring a vast world with creatures called “Pals”. You can fight these companions and capture them to help you build a base, travel around, and fight enemies.

One fun thing about Palworld is that you can give your friends guns. This has led some to call it a “Pokémon with a gun” as it is similar to a Pokémon but with a weapon. You can also have your companions perform tasks for you at your base, such as mining or working in factories.

You can play Palworld by yourself or with others online, with up to 32 players on the server. It launches in early access in January 2024 on computers and Xbox consoles. People have different opinions about Palworld. Some liked its gameplay and fun ideas, while others felt it relied too much on shock humor and wasn’t very creative.

But despite mixed reviews, Palworld was still very successful. It sells well and has millions of players on the large gaming platform Steam. This makes it one of the most popular games ever on Steam.

Friends world gameplay

In Palworld, players embark on an adventure in a vibrant and diverse world filled with creatures known as Pals. Players control a character to explore the vast landscape of the Palpagos Islands, encountering various challenges along the way.

Survival is a big part of the game, which means players need to keep an eye on their hunger levels, gather resources, and build a base to stay safe. They can craft tools and structures using materials found throughout the islands, which also serve as convenient travel points.

One of the unique features of Palworld is the ability to capture Pals after fighting them. Players can weaken friends in battle and then capture them using special items called “Buddy Balls.” These captured companions can be summoned to aid in combat or be assigned tasks at the player’s base, such as gathering resources or cooking food.

Each companion has its own special abilities, called companion skills, which players can utilize in a variety of ways. For example, some companions can be used as mounts or even weapons, adding strategic depth to combat and exploration.

However, in Palworld, players are not alone. The islands are home to different factions, each with their own agenda. From criminal syndicates to liberation movements, players will encounter a variety of organizations during their journey. These factions are led by powerful trainers who serve as the game’s main bosses.

Additionally, the world is populated by human NPCs, some of which may be hostile to players. If the player commits a criminal act, such as attacking an NPC or stealing, it will attract the attention of the law enforcement NPC, leading to a fierce confrontation.

Friends world system requirements

at the lowest limit:

  • Requires 64-bit processor and operating system
  • Operating system: Windows 10 or higher (64-bit)
  • Processor: i5-3570K 3.4 GHz 4 core
  • Memory: 16 GB RAM
  • Graphics card: GeForce GTX 1050 (2GB)
  • DirectX: Version 11
  • Network: Broadband Internet connection
  • Storage: 40 GB available space

Respected:

  • Requires 64-bit processor and operating system
  • Operating system: Windows 10 or higher (64-bit)
  • Processor: i9-9900K 3.6 GHz 8-core
  • Memory: 32 GB RAM
  • Graphics card: GeForce RTX 2070
  • DirectX: Version 11
  • Network: Broadband Internet connection
  • Storage: 40 GB available space
